About Deron Williams Deron Williams is a professional basketball player from Parkersburg, West Virginia.He is a three-time NBA All-Star who plays for the Brooklyn Nets. He has also played for the Utah Jazz and the Besiktas in the Turkish Basketball League in 2011, during the NBA lockout.Deron Williams was also a gold medalist from the United States National Team. He was an active and athletic person, from a young age. He competed in state wrestling championships in elementary school and middle school. At eight years old, he won the 67 lb (30 kg) category at the Texas State Championship, in 1993. He continued his wrestling career and in 1997 at the age of 12, he won the 116 lb (52.6 kg) category. Williams attended Colony High School in Texas. He continued to compete in sports at Colony High School and did very well.During his high school career, he averaged 17 points, 9.4 assists, and two steals in every game at the junior level, in 2001. Deron Williams’s average was 17.6 points with 8.5 assists 6.1 rebounds and 2.6 deals per game in 2002. His record attracted the attention of recruiters. He was eventually recruited by Bill Self to play college basketball at the University of Illinois in the 2002-2003 NCAA season.He ranked third in the big ten conferences in his freshman year, with 4.53 assists per game. In his college years, he worked hard to improve his game. He was able to improve his scoring average from 6.3 to 14 points, per game, and worked on his assists per game. He eventually was able to make an average of 6.17 assists, per game.After the 2004-2005 NCAA season, Williams received multiple awards. These awards and honors included him being named a First-Team All-American, Second-Team All-American, Big Ten All-Tournament Team, and an All-Final Four Team, at the end of the academic year. Deron Williams and Amy Young Williams have four children together.Career And Professional HighlightsBest Known For…Williams was recommended for the NBA draft after the 2005 season. The Utah Jazz selected Deron Williams in their third selection. He started the season as a starting point guard but was later sent back to the bench. In this season, Deron Williams’s average was 10.8 points and 4.5 assists per game. He was also named NBA All-Rookie First Team and received first-place votes, along with another player, in the 2005-2006 NBA voting year.Deron Williams played with the Utah Jazz in the NBA championships from 2005 to 2011. He often led the team and was given many awards for his talents. He was counted as one of the best players on the team. In 2011, Williams was traded to the New Jersey Nets.In the 2011 NBA lockout, he had a short, one-year contract to play with the Besiktas on a contract that was worth $5 million. After the NBA lockout, he went back to New Jersey and played with the team until March 2012. In 2012, he signed another contract to play with New Jersey; it was worth $98.7 million. In July 2015, he signed with the Dallas Mavericks. In his debut game, Williams scored 12 points and seven assists. The team won 111-95.
